Call for Papers
Association of Business Historians
23rd Annual Conference, 3-4 July 2015,
University of Exeter Business School
Business and the Periphery
The Association of Business Historians 23rd Annual Conference will be held on 3-4  July 2015 at the University of Exeter Business School on the beautiful Streatham  campus.

The conference theme will be ‘Business and the Periphery’. The conference will  explore the boundaries of business history and the conference committee will interpret  this theme broadly to welcome paper and session proposals which address historical  themes relating, but not limited, to business operating on economic, financial,  geographical, social, political, religious, technological, legal, regulatory and other  peripheries.

The conference will feature a roundtable on ‘Business History after the Research  Excellence Framework (REF)’. The Tony Slaven Doctoral Workshop will precede  the conference on 2-3 July 2015 and will be subject to a separate call, as will the
Coleman Prize for the best PhD thesis on business history completed on a British subject or at a British university.

The conference committee welcomes proposals for individual papers or complete research tracks of 90 minutes in length. Each individual paper proposal should include a short abstract, a list of 3 to 5 key words, and a brief CV of the presenter.
Proposals for research tracks should include a cover letter containing a session title and the rationale for the research track. The organisers also welcome research papers on any topic related to business history which are outside of the conference theme.
